True Religion Apparel Announces First Quarter 2011 Financial Results

 

·                  Q1 2011 net sales increased 20.4% to $93.8 million

·                  U.S. Consumer Direct net sales increased 37.6%; same-store sales increased 7.4%

·                  International net sales increased 34.0% to $18.5 million

·                  Q1 2011 diluted earnings per share were $0.36 versus $0.34 in Q1 2010

 

VERNON, California — April 28, 2011—True Religion Apparel, Inc. (Nasdaq: TRLG) today announced financial results for the quarter ended March 31, 2011.

 

First Quarter 2011 Financial Results

 

·                  Total net sales increased 20.4% to $93.8 million.

 

·                  Net sales for the Company’s U.S. Consumer Direct segment, which includes the Company’s branded retail stores and e-commerce site, increased 37.6% to $53.4 million and accounted for 56.9% of the Company’s total net sales for the quarter. First quarter same-store sales for the 76 stores open at least 12 months and e-commerce increased 7.4%. The Company operated a total of 96 branded stores in the United States as of March 31, 2011, compared to 76 as of March 31, 2010.

 

·                  Net sales for the Company’s U.S. Wholesale segment totaled $20.9 million, a 13.6% decrease as compared to the prior year. This segment’s sales continue to be impacted by the overall challenging sales trend for women’s premium denim in the major department store channel.  In addition, the Company’s sales to off-price customers were reduced to support long-term brand value.

 

·                  Net sales for the Company’s International segment increased 34.0% to $18.5 million. Growth in the segment was driven by the transition to a joint venture in Germany in August 2010 as well as sales increases in Korea and Canada.

 

·                  Gross profit increased 21.6% to $60.7 million, driven primarily by the overall sales growth.  The gross margin rate increased 60 basis points to 64.8%, reflecting the ongoing net sales mix shift towards the higher-margin U.S. Consumer direct segment.

 



 

·                  Selling, general and administrative (“SG&A”) expenses, as a percentage of net sales, increased to 48.9% from 47.0% in the same quarter a year ago.  The SG&A rate declined for each segment except the International segment, which increased SG&A due to the addition over the past year of our EMEA managing director, regional headquarters staff in Switzerland, wholesale sales personnel in Germany, the UK and Italy, and retail sales personnel for five new retail stores.

 

·                  Operating income totaled $14.9 million, up 11.3% from the first quarter of last year. Operating margin was 15.8% in the first quarter of 2011 versus 17.1% in first quarter of 2010. The operating margin benefited primarily from an improvement in the Consumer Direct segment’s operating margin, which was driven by the 7.4% same-store sales increase. This was offset by the increase in SG&A expenses in the International segment.

 

·                  The effective tax rate for the quarter was 38.8% as compared to 37.2% in the first quarter of 2010.  The 2011 effective tax rate increased over 2010 as the Company established its European headquarters in Switzerland.

 

·                  Net income attributable to True Religion Apparel, Inc. increased to $9.0 million, or $0.36 per diluted share based on weighted average shares outstanding of 25.1 million, as compared to $8.4 million, or $0.34 per diluted share based on weighted average shares outstanding of 24.9 million in the 2010 first quarter.

 

Management Comments

 

“We are off to a good start for 2011 as we exceeded our net sales and profitability targets for the first quarter of the year.  The standout performance this quarter was our Consumer Direct segment, which benefitted from new store openings, a same-store sales increase of 7.4% and consistent operating cost oversight, and delivered a 260 basis point increase in operating margin.  We also achieved a 34% increase in our international net sales, as we benefited from strategic investments and more direct control of our business in those markets,” stated Jeffrey Lubell, Chairman, Chief Executive Officer and Chief Merchant of True Religion Apparel, Inc.  “We are aware of the challenges that face the overall retail market for premium denim and will continue to execute our plans to mitigate input cost pressures, protect our premium brand position and maintain strict inventory discipline. The strategic investments we have made in our domestic retail stores over the past years are generating healthy net sales and cash flow, and we plan that our substantial investments in EMEA, which are classified as operating costs, will create a platform for future sales and earnings growth.”

 

Balance Sheet and Liquidity

 

As of March 31, 2011, the Company had $156.2 million of cash and cash equivalents as compared to $153.8 million as of December 31, 2010. The Company ended the quarter with no long-term borrowings. Over the past year, the Company added inventory to support the 20 U.S.

 



 

and five international branded retail stores opened since March 31, 2010, expanded its wholesale sales presence in Germany, and added two initiatives that contributed to the overall inventory increase: selling excess wholesale merchandise through Company outlet stores versus off-price wholesale accounts, and consolidating new fashion merchandise for retail stores into one shipment at the beginning of the month. These developments resulted in an inventory balance of $46.6 million as of March 31, 2011, a 38.3% increase from the end of the first quarter of 2010 and an 11.8% increase from the beginning of 2011.

 

Net cash provided by operating activities for the first quarter of 2011 was $10.9 million compared to $12.5 million in first quarter of 2010.  This decrease in net cash provided by operating activities is related to the additional investment in inventory described above.

 

Store Openings

 

During the 2011 first quarter, True Religion Apparel opened two stores in the U.S. and one store in Germany.  As of March 31, 2011, the Company operated 96 stores in the U.S., four stores in Japan, one store in the U.K., two stores in Germany, and one store in Canada.  The Company anticipates opening 20 additional retail stores in 2011, including 13 stores in the U.S. and seven stores outside the U.S.

About True Religion Apparel, Inc.

 

True Religion Apparel, Inc. is a growing, design-based jeans and jeans-related sportswear brand. The Company designs, manufactures and markets True Religion Apparel products, including its premium True Religion Brand Jeans. Its expanding product line, which includes high-quality, distinctive styling and fit in denim, sportswear, and licensed products, may be found in the Company’s branded retail stores as well as contemporary department stores and boutiques in 50 countries on six continents. As of March 31, 2011, the Company owned and operated 96 branded retail stores in the United States, four branded retail stores in Japan, one branded retail store in the United Kingdom, two branded retail stores in Germany, and one branded retail store in Canada.
